There are a number of factors that contribute to the value of any watch. The best way to get an accurate figure for how much your Yacht-Master is worth is to send details of your watch to us using the form above so that we can provide you with a personalised estimate. Our comprehensive valuation process accounts for factors such as:
Model Specifics
Different Yacht-Master models and references have unique attributes that can affect their value.
Watch Condition
The overall condition of your Yacht-Master, including wear and maintenance history, plays a crucial role in its valuation.
Market Trends
Our experts continuously monitor the luxury watch market to ensure your offer reflects the most up-to-date demand for Yacht-Masters.
Provenance & Accessories
Original packaging, documentation, and accessories such as straps can enhance the desirability and value of your Yacht-Master.
Q: Does the Yacht-Master hold value?
A: Yes, the Rolex Yacht-Master tends to hold its value well over time. Like most Rolex models, the Yacht-Master benefits from the brand's reputation for quality, durability, and timeless design.
Q: Can I sell my Yacht-Master without the box and papers?
A: Yes, you can still sell your Yacht-Master even if you don't have either or both of the box and papers. While having the complete set can potentially increase its value, these items are not essential for a sale and we're able to accurately appraise watches without the original box or papers.
Q: How do I prepare my Rolex Yacht-Master for sale?
A: To prepare your Yacht-Master for sale, ensure it is clean and all accompanying items (such as the box, papers, and any spare links) are gathered. High-quality, clear photos of the watch and its accessories can also expedite the valuation process.
